Tattvaa Yogashala is the first and oldest Ashtanga and Hatha yoga school in
Rishikesh, India, and the only yoga school located on the banks of the
Ganges. Founded in 2000 by senior teacher Yogi Kamal Singh in the world's
yoga capital, it has since expanded and become a haven for study and
practice for yogis worldwide.
It all began in our small Shala, or school, on the banks of the sacred
Ganges. Prior to being a yoga space, the small yogashala functioned as a
shelter for pilgrims from across India to spend time with the Ganga and in
the holy city of Rishikesh. Our Yoga Alliance-certified schools in India
continue to carry the vibrancy of all who come to Rishikesh as seekers. It
is now home for the yoga students who have also come from far away on their
pilgrimages. Every year the Ganga comes to bless the shala with a flood,
taking away all the exhausted energy and refreshing it with her divine
power. The Yogashala is both a vibrant and inspiring place to practise, with
its history and location overlooking the Ganga water.
